Dear Parent,

As Head of Trinity, it is my privilege to welcome you warmly to our school.

You will find that the Trinity community is vibrant, diverse, creative and innovative, promoting the values of the Church of England yet at the same time welcoming students of different faiths. We value all our students, and our aim is to provide a first class educational opportunity based on high aims and high expectations.

Trinity is an extremely popular choice amongst parents and students. Our examination results are well above national averages, and we have a commitment to the use of technology across the curriculum. We offer a vast range of activities beyond the classroom, notably in sport, music, drama and dance.

We believe in enabling the children of today to develop into the responsible, confident, young citizens of tomorrow, with the professional qualifications and personal qualities so necessary for success in a challenging and diverse society.
